Crazy...check out this queue and the chaos at London's Regent Street H&M store last week.

Why all the fuss?
Lanvin at H&M!

Good thing this wasn't happening this week instead of last, or I might have insisted asked my sweet hubby to spend the night in that line for me since he just so happens to be shopping in London. ;)


99.00 GBP for this dress that would normally sell for upwards of 2,000.00 GBP.
People were limited to one Lanvin item each and most of the 200 stores worldwide sold out of the 80 piece women's collection within the first two days.

Vintage turkey images glued to charger plates she found at a thrift store.
This light burlap tablecloth has totally inspired me. This would be a great every day solution for my dark wood table. As Ashley was sewing the pieces together for her holiday tablecloth she realized that the underside was a bit more fun than the finished edges. Fray the underside edges a bit and wow~ a totally unexpected and chic solution. If you go to Ashley's blog {here} you can watch her tutorial on making many of these things for her holiday table. The acorn centerpiece was a 2x4 piece of scrap wood which she glued paper to the outside of(weathered paint background), adding the moss and acorns to the top.

She also shows how she made this lamp shade cover out of burlap scraps.
Cute vintage Thanksgiving postcards and paper are from the Graphics Fairy.
